在EXCEL中,一个单元格中的数字带单位,与另一个单元格中的数字相乘,可以用公式吗?

如题所述

可以

公式: =LEFT(B42,LEN(B42)-1)*C42 如图  

解释:len函数是取单元格字符串长度,减去1 是指单位长度,如果你的单位是公斤,那么久减去2,left是取单元格左边字符串,明白否?

温馨提示:答案为网友推荐,仅供参考
第1个回答  2012-03-08
可以
假设你的这个带单位的在a1
另一个数值在b1
c1内求积
在c1内输入=-LOOKUP(0,-LEFT(A1,ROW($1:$8)))*b1
第2个回答  2012-03-08
=MID(A1,1,1)*B1&"元"
假如A1单元格是 1元,B1是纯数字,那么用上面公式 可以相乘,并把单位也加上去了。
第3个回答  2012-03-08
取A2单元格中数字公式
=LOOKUP(,0/LEFT(A2,ROW(INDIRECT("1:"&LEN(A2)))),LEFT(A2,ROW(INDIRECT("1:"&LEN(A2))))) 数组公式
以后怎么做你懂。
相似回答